Important differences between peppermint and strudel

  • Peppermint has more vitamin A, fiber, magnesium, and potassium; however, strudel has more vitamin B12, vitamin B6, phosphorus, vitamin B1, and vitamin B3.
  • Strudel's daily need coverage for vitamin B12 is 67% more.
  • Peppermint has 8 times more potassium than strudel. Peppermint has 569mg of potassium, while strudel has 71mg.
  • Peppermint is lower in sodium.
  • Peppermint has a higher glycemic index than strudel.

The food varieties used in the comparison are Peppermint, fresh and KELLOGG'S, EGGO, Wafflers, Strawberry Strudel.
